My girlfriend are on a quest to visit all the lesbian bars in the country, and luckily my sister…read moregoes to school in Bloomington. The weekend we went happened to be Bloomington Pride, so this place was packed. A fun mixture of college students, 20 something's, and older folks. You enter through a tall fence off of an alleyway, so I'm guessing it's challenging to find if you don't know where you're going, but that's part of the fun. Of the 4 lesbian bars we've been to, this place wins for best decor hands down. We're talking zebra print walls, stuffed unicorn heads, yonic art, glow in the dark paint. Great vibes. They have a super cute outdoor patio as well, and I loved the little food truck on the patio that opens at 9 pm! Great waffle fries and hot sandwiches. Nothing hits as right as hot cheese when you're drunk. They have tons of fun specialty drinks on a menu behind the bar! Also a great mocktail menu for the sober community! Everyone was super welcoming in this space. The one complaint I have is the Dj... we came here to dance the night away and barely made it to 11 pm because the DJ didn't play any recognizable songs or songs with a dancing beat. There were only around 10 people on the dance floor at a given time. On the other hand, this is the first lesbian bar I've been in that has had an operational dance floor with anyone on it, so that's a win. I can't wait to come back again the next time I visit Bloomington!

The original Bluebird was about half the size it is today. Several years ago, they bought out the restaurant next door and added a large additional space, leading to a pretty big bar/nightclub with a 'bar area' that includes a nice full bar, booths and tables, and the 'live music' portion which has a big stage, plenty of room for big crowds, and a warehouse vibe that is second to none. When you arrive, you'll start to see pictures of the amazing acts that run thru the Bluebird when they're just on the cusp of being 'huge' - from REM to Miranda Lambert to Gryffin, just about every genre is represented and it's nice to say 'I saw them with a few hundred of my friends' after you give ticketmaster your kidney to pay for their giant stadium shows. A classic IU and Bloomington live music tradition since 1973! Gotta check it out if you're ever in…read moreB-town. Such greats as John Cougar Mellencamp to Bill Monroe & The Blue Grass Boys have played there. If the walls of the place could only speak... and check out the walls for photos of the many famous bands that have played there. #TheBluebird
